One thing I just, I thought was worth saying is, you see polls from people saying ICE is making cities less safe, right?
And those are polls of people that aren't there, I mean, for the most part.
And so they're reacting to the chaos they're seeing.
And so that's a kind of aesthetic judgment, like this looks like it's not good, right?
It's a good judgment, it's correct.
But then you talk to people about what it's actually like, and to people that are trying to kind of assist in the communities, and they are seeing people afraid to call the police.
They're seeing people afraid to go to the hospital, afraid to report domestic abuse, afraid to get warm in the cold.
And that is a community that is less safe because of this chaos, because of the presence of ICE.
